This 60,000 sq. ft. 2 two-story Tenant Improvement project for Workday Inc. is designed around a village concept in which departments and other programmatic elements are defined by a variety of elements. A serpentine path functions as a main square by connecting reception to a main conference room, then to each department activated by an adjacent break room. Floor patterns, ceiling patterns and view corridors vary within the transition of each neighborhood to define the diversity of space. Along with a generous placement of small huddle rooms, employees are finally engaged by a visual play between Workday Inc.’s blue and orange brand colors.
